VIM: reselect visual selection after encodeing change

This change makes vim re-select the portion of text that was changed
after an encoding change.
Jonathan Hodgson 3 years ago
parent 60da2caac1
commit ff6c1c304b
  1. 2
      nvim/.config/nvim/autoload/mine/encoding.vim

@ -56,7 +56,7 @@ function! mine#encoding#wrapper(fn) abort
" transform text
" adapted from: https://github.com/christianrondeau/vim-base64/blob/master/autoload/base64.vim#L36
execute "normal! c\<c-r>=mine#encoding#" . a:fn . "(@\")\<cr>\<esc>"
execute "normal! c\<c-r>=mine#encoding#" . a:fn . "(@\")\<cr>\<esc>`[v`]h"
" reset paste to whatever it was before
let &paste = l:paste

Loading…
Cancel
Save